> > Description of problem: I have a problem starting from a template .xidv 
> > bundle (attached) that I like.
> > Multiple data sources, 11 displays.
> >
> > 1. I changed the time driver end date to 1999-09-16.
> > 2. I saved the resulting session (hurricane Floyd) to a .zidv bundle.
> > 3. I opened the .zidv bundle in a fresh IDV session.
> > The IR satellite is shown for the right times, but the others (TRMM,MERRA) 
> > don't animate. They appear right at the initial frame but they don't move. .
